Georgian Courts Wellington FL — Homes for Sale, HOA, and What Buyers Need to Know

Georgian Courts is one of the few places in Wellington where buyers can find gated access at mid-tier pricing. That combination is rare. In a market where many gated communities sit firmly in the luxury bracket, Georgian Courts gives buyers another path.

For buyers who want a controlled-entry neighborhood without stepping up into Wellington’s highest gated price tiers, Georgian Courts can be one of the most practical options to consider.

What Makes Georgian Courts Different

The main differentiator is simple: the gate is real, the resort is not.

Georgian Courts offers controlled access and a quieter residential feel that many buyers specifically want. What it does not offer is the full resort-style infrastructure that usually comes with Wellington’s higher-end gated communities. Buyers here are choosing the gate, the neighborhood feel, and the pricing advantage — not the oversized clubhouse and luxury amenity package.

Why Buyers Pay Attention to This Community

Many buyers in Wellington are told they have to make a trade-off. Either stay in the mid-tier and give up the gate, or pay luxury pricing to get it. Georgian Courts is one of the few communities where that trade-off changes.

That makes it especially attractive to buyers who have lived in gated communities before and know exactly what they value about that experience: reduced through-traffic, more controlled access, and a stronger neighborhood feel.

The HOA Question Buyers Should Ask First

In a gated community, the gate itself is a capital item. It has components that age, wear out, and eventually need replacement. That is why one of the smartest pre-offer questions is not just about the HOA fee, but about the HOA reserve fund and capital planning.

Before buying in Georgian Courts, buyers should ask:

  • How healthy is the HOA reserve fund?
  • Is the gate system listed in the capital improvement plan?
  • Are there any pending or possible special assessments?
  • What is the maintenance history of the gate infrastructure?

When buyers skip those questions, they can end up inheriting future costs they did not plan for.

What Else Buyers Should Verify

As with any resale home in South Florida, due diligence should also include:

  • Roof age and insurance impact
  • HVAC age and condition
  • Permit history for additions or changes
  • Electrical and plumbing condition
  • School assignment by specific address

These are standard checks, but they matter even more when buyers are comparing Georgian Courts to both non-gated mid-tier communities and higher-priced gated alternatives.

Who Georgian Courts Is Right For

Georgian Courts works best for buyers who want:

  • A Wellington address
  • Controlled access
  • Mid-tier pricing
  • A neighborhood-first lifestyle instead of a resort-first lifestyle

Who It May Not Fit

This community may not be the best fit for buyers whose top priority is a luxury amenity package, expansive clubhouse environment, or full resort-style pool complex. Those buyers may need to shop in Wellington’s higher gated price tiers.
